Thanks again, 73, -Dave W3DJS On Mon, Jun 24, 2019 at 5:26 PM Bill Somerville <g4...@classdesign.com> wrote: > On 24/06/2019 18:46, Dave Slotter wrote: > > I was wondering, if WSJT-X uses HamLib, and at least some rigs are > > capable of setting and getting the transmit power, why do users have > > to fill in the Log QSO Field, "Tx power", manually? Is there a reason > > for not implementing this feature? > > Hi Dave, > > the main reason is inaccuracy. Using AFSK modes allows the power to be > controlled in many ways including using the audio level into the rig. > The power setting on the rig may have little bearing on the actual > radiated power. The rigs that allow metering the power leaving the > transceiver PA could be more accurate but require constant polling of > the Tx power meter level while transmitting. Even if the above were not > an issue, an individual station may be using a PA after the transceiver. > In summary, the user has a much better idea of the radiated power than > any indirect measurement available via CAT commands. > > For a counter example, measuring SNR of received signals is far more > deterministic and reliable and we happily support that as an automated > feature in the WSJT-X modes. > > 73 > Bill > G4WJS. > > > > _______________________________________________ > wsjt-devel mailing list > wsjt-devel@lists.sourceforge.net > https://lists.sourceforge.net/lists/listinfo/wsjt-devel >
